php实现登录和注册的区别在哪

介绍

PHP是一门广泛使用的服务器端脚本语言,它可以在网页中嵌入HTML,也可以作为独立的程序运行。登录和注册是Web应用程序中最普遍的任务之一,而PHP可以很好地处理这些任务。本文将介绍通过PHP实现登录与注册过程的区别。

登录过程

在登录过程中,用户需要提供用户名和密码以验证其身份。PHP通常使用的方法是将用户提供的用户名和密码与先前存储在数据库中的用户名和密码进行比较。如果它们匹配,则允许用户访问应用程序。下面是PHP的浅显例子:

```

```

代码中包括两个主要部分。第一部分是开启一个新的或者从已存在的session中加载数据。接下来,检查用户是否单击了“登录”按钮,如果是,则提取用户提交的用户名和密码。其后,将用户名和密码与先前存储的值中的用户输入进行比较,如果匹配,则使用PHP内置函数header()将用户重定向到主页。

注册过程

在注册过程中,用户需要提供必要的详细信息以创建一个账户。通常,注册表单包含必填项,例如电子邮件地址、用户名、密码等等。PHP通常将这些详细信息存储在数据库中完成用户注册的过程。下面是PHP的浅显例子:

```

```

代码中,首先检测用户是否单击了“注册”按钮,并提取用户提交的用户名、密码和电子邮件地址等详细信息。使用mysqli_connect()函数连接到数据库,将详细信息存储到数据库中,执行查询以完成用户注册。

总结

PHP是一种非常流行的编程语言,广泛用于Web开发。在Web应用程序中,登录和注册是最常见的任务之一。PHP提供了方便的方法来验证用户凭据并将用户详细信息存储到数据库中,实现登录和注册过程。同时,登录和注册过程在实现上有很大的不同,需要同样的重视。在实际应用中,通过对不断地测试和优化,开发者能够更好地评估并掌握不同实现所需的时间和资源成本。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/php-ryr.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月3日 上午4:38
下一篇 2023年5月3日 上午4:38

猜你喜欢